Meet Bumple and Little Mop: stars of a wild and wonderful new adventure from award-winning author and artist Helen Kellock.
A story about what it really means to be wild, from an award-winning author and artist. In a forgotten part of the sea, there lies a secret island: the Isle of Begg. Its shores are wild and wonderful, with creatures of every kind... But there's one little creature, called Bumple, who has no interest in the island's wonders – she'd much rather stay put in her cosy home patch. It's only when a mischievous little beastie crash lands in her world that Bumple begins to realize ... a little bit of wildness can be a LOT of fun!

About Helen Kellock

Helen Kellock is an illustrator and artist based in Glasgow with a Masters in Illustration from the Glasgow School of Art. Her sample artwork for The Star in the Forest won the Batsford Prize for Children's Illustration 2018 and was highly commended for the Macmillan Book Prize.
